Let’s start with Kim Kardashian, whose ensemble, quite enigmatically, seemed to echo the whispers of the past. Collaborating with British pop artist Allen Jones, Kim donned a remarkable tangerine-hued fibreglass breastplate, a mesmerizing homage to the late 1960s. This sculptural marvel, reimagined from an original cast, lent her outfit an aura of art history-yet it whispered of movement, inviting the vibrancy of the Met carpet rather than remaining a mere relic. Paired with a sleek leather skirt crafted by the artisans at Whitaker Malem, Kim took us on a timeless journey, proving that nostalgia can indeed dance alongside modernity.
Next up was Kylie Jenner, who not only turned heads but also redefined the laws of perceptual fashion in a daring Schiaparelli creation. The upper portion of her look-a nude strapless bodysuit-was a sophisticated illusion, creating the tantalizing effect of a barely-there silhouette. Yet, as we shifted our gaze downward, the narrative unfolded into a voluminous skirt, richly embroidered with pale florals and botanical motifs. Draped in creamy ivory, it cascaded like a poetic waterfall, each bloom adding drama to her ethereal presence. Styled impeccably with a diamond choker, loose waves, and those audacious bleached brows, Kylie transformed simplicity into a statement.
Then we have Kendall Jenner, who opted for a more classical approach, donning a custom piece from GapStudio by the illustrious Zac Posen. Channeling the spirit of the famed Winged Victory of Samothrace, Kendall draped herself in a gown that whispered the elegance of Grecian antiquity. The beauty of this ensemble lay in its subtle subversion-what appeared to be a classical silhouette at first glance was ingeniously rendered from the most everyday of garments, a humble Gap T-shirt.
